/**
 * The **eap** module provides the extensible authentication mechanism to enable third-party clients to access custom 80
 * 2.1X (a port-based network access control protocol) authentication, such as Extensible Authentication Protocol (EAP)
 * authentication.
 *
 * @syscap SystemCapability.Communication.NetManager.Eap
 * @since 20 dynamic
 */
declare namespace eap {
  /**
   * Registers a custom handler of Extensible Authentication Protocol (EAP) packets for extensible authentication. This
   * API returns the result asynchronously through a callback.
   *
   * The system will encapsulate the eligible EAP packets into the callback function for enterprise applications to
   * retrieve.
   *
   * @permission ohos.permission.MANAGE_ENTERPRISE_WIFI_CONNECTION
   * @param { int } netType - Network type. The value can be **1** or **2**.
   *     <br>The value **1** indicates WLAN, and the value **2** indicates Ethernet.
   * @param { int } eapCode - EAP code. The value can be any of the following:
   *     <br>code=1 Request, code=2 Response, code=3 Success, code=4 Failure.
   * @param { int } eapType - EAP method. The value range is [0, 255].
   *     <br>Common values include the following: eapType=1 Identity, eapType=2 Notification, eapType=3 NAK, eapType=4
   *     MD5-Challenge, eapType=5 OTP (One-Time Password), eapType=6 GTC (Generic Token Card), eapType=13 EAP-TLS,
   *     eapType=21 EAP-TTLS, eapType=25 EAP-PEAP, eapType=254 Expanded Types, and eapType=255 Experimental use.
   * @param { Callback<EapData> } callback - Callback function, which returns the packet of the specified eapCode+
   *     eapType.
   * @throws { BusinessError } 201 - Permission denied.
   * @throws { BusinessError } 33200006 - Invalid net type
   * @throws { BusinessError } 33200007 - Invalid eap code
   * @throws { BusinessError } 33200008 - Invalid eap type
   * @throws { BusinessError } 33200009 - netmanager stop
   * @throws { BusinessError } 33200099 - internal error
   * @syscap SystemCapability.Communication.NetManager.Eap
   * @since 20 dynamic
   */
  function regCustomEapHandler(netType: int, eapCode: int, eapType: int, callback: Callback<EapData>): void;

  /**
   * Notifies the system of the extensible authentication result.
   *
   * > **NOTE**
   * >
   * > - If this callback is used to process received EAP data packets, the customized portion added by the server must
   * > be removed from the EAP data transmitted to the system.
   * >
   * > - If this callback is used to process sent EAP data packets, the EAP data transmitted to the system is the EAP
   * > data with the customized portion added by the server.
   *
   * @permission ohos.permission.MANAGE_ENTERPRISE_WIFI_CONNECTION
   * @param { CustomResult } result - Extensible authentication result.
   * @param { EapData } data - EAP data.
   * @throws { BusinessError } 201 - Permission denied.
   * @throws { BusinessError } 33200004 - Invalid result
   * @throws { BusinessError } 33200005 - Invalid size of eap data
   * @throws { BusinessError } 33200009 - netmanager stop
   * @throws { BusinessError } 33200099 - internal error
   * @syscap SystemCapability.Communication.NetManager.Eap
   * @since 20 dynamic
   */
  function replyCustomEapData(result: CustomResult, data: EapData): void;

  /**
   * Starts EAP authentication on an Ethernet NIC.
   *
   * @permission ohos.permission.MANAGE_ENTERPRISE_WIFI_CONNECTION
   * @param { int } netId - ID of the Ethernet NIC. If the default value **-1** is specified, the system automatically
   *     matches the Ethernet NIC to initiate EAP authentication.
   * @param { EthEapProfile } profile - EAP profile.
   * @throws { BusinessError } 201 - Permission denied.
   * @throws { BusinessError } 33200001 - Invalid netId
   * @throws { BusinessError } 33200003 - Invalid profile
   * @throws { BusinessError } 33200009 - netmanager stop
   * @throws { BusinessError } 33200010 - invalid eth state
   * @throws { BusinessError } 33200099 - internal error
   * @syscap SystemCapability.Communication.NetManager.Eap
   * @since 20 dynamic
   */
  function startEthEap(netId: int, profile: EthEapProfile): void;

  /**
   * Revokes the EAP-authenticated state of an Ethernet NIC.
   *
   * @permission ohos.permission.MANAGE_ENTERPRISE_WIFI_CONNECTION
   * @param { int } netId - ID of the Ethernet NIC. If the default value **-1** is specified, the system automatically
   *     matches the Ethernet NIC to initiate EAP authentication.
   * @throws { BusinessError } 201 - Permission denied.
   * @throws { BusinessError } 33200001 - Invalid netId
   * @throws { BusinessError } 33200002 - Log off fail
   * @throws { BusinessError } 33200009 - netmanager stop
   * @throws { BusinessError } 33200010 - invalid eth state
   * @throws { BusinessError } 33200099 - internal error
   * @syscap SystemCapability.Communication.NetManager.Eap
   * @since 20 dynamic
   */
  function logOffEthEap(netId: int): void;
